### Image slimming — how we keep builds small

Welcome aboard! The Pareline build pipeline strips debug symbols, squashes layers, and evicts anything not referenced by the runtime manifest. Don't fight the slimmer; if your tool vanishes from the image, add it to the keep-list instead of disabling stages. Budgets are enforced at merge time, so oversized images fail CI before they ever hit the Dunmore registry. The enforcement thresholds are defined as constants, shown here.

constants for bagaf-hadup:
QUOTAS = {
    "quenael": 1,
    "ralwyn": 1,
    "oliath": 2,
    "ulaael": 2,
}

Hey — handing off the waveform preview in Chordlet before I rotate teams. The renderer downsamples audio to 800 peak buckets and draws them on a canvas; resizing re-buckets lazily, which is why narrow windows look chunky for a frame. Known quirk: stereo files only show the left channel, tracked in the backlog. Tests cover mono and stereo fixtures under preview/spec. If something weird shows up in production, the component now belongs to the engineer named below.

account owner for bawip-tahag: Raleth Quenok

# Break-Glass Access: Renderhollow Transcode Farm

If the Renderhollow scheduler is wedged and the normal admin console is unreachable, use the break-glass account on the farm's management node. This bypasses the standard approval flow, so file an incident record within one hour of use. The account is protected by a recovery passphrase rotated quarterly by the infrastructure lead. The current passphrase follows.

vault phrase of taweg-kafof = oliax-zorael

Subject: DR Drill Friday — Branchsweeper Bot

Hi, welcome aboard. This Friday we're running a disaster-recovery drill on Branchsweeper, our stale-branch cleanup bot. We'll simulate a total loss of its state database and restore from the Coldhollow snapshot. Your part is simple: follow the restore script and confirm the bot resumes pruning without deleting active branches. The restore prompt will ask for the recovery passphrase noted just below.

vault phrase of bagaf-kajeg = jorath-feniel-briir-siliel-ralix